PlanB: Bitcoin Breakout Above $60,000 Range “Is Just a Matter of Time”
Crypto analyst PlanB opined on the X platform that “$60,000 is the new $10,000,” suggesting that Bitcoin's current price behavior in the $60,000 range could recreate its previous pattern in the $10,000 range.
A long-term chart of Bitcoin's realized price shared by PlanB shows that between 2018 and 2020, Bitcoin experienced long-term volatility in the $10,000 range. Currently, the Bitcoin price is showing similar characteristics in the $60,000 range. This similarity may signal that Bitcoin is on the verge of a significant new rally, similar to the previous breakout from $10,000 to $60,000, and PlanB emphasizes that it's “only a matter of time” before Bitcoin's price breaks out to the upside.
